This three-year interdisciplinary program, offered in collaboration with NYU's School of Global Public Health, is designed for students pursuing a global perspective that integrates social work and public health. Upon graduation, participants will receive both a Master of Social Work (MSW) and a Master of Public Health (MPH). The curriculum draws on expertise from five NYU schools: the Silver School of Social Work, Robert F. Wagner Graduate School of Public Service, School of Medicine, College of Dentistry, and Steinhardt School of Culture, Education, and Human Development. Dual-degree candidates maintain full-time status while completing coursework for both programs simultaneously. Both degrees are awarded only after all requirements for each program are satisfied.
